Back Pain
Q: My back has been killing me for several years now.
Nothing seems to work. Can Naturopathic physicians do anything
for my problem?
A: The solution to your problem often depends on what the
root of the problem is. If you have back pain due to a severely
herniated disc, chances are surgery is necessary for a complete
recovery. Unfortunately, this is only part of the solution.
Surgery may correct an underlying defect in the disc but it
usually does not address why the disc herniated in the first
place. The most overlooked cause of back pain is ligament
laxity. Ligaments are tissues that “brace” bone
to bone throughout the body, allowing for stabilization of
every joint. When ligaments are injured, they are often stretched
slightly. This leads to compromised ability to stabilize the
joints. This is often why an “old” injury from
many years ago keeps coming back to haunt you whenever you
exert yourself. The best therapy to restore joint stability
of lax ligaments is PROLOTHERAPY, which involves injections
of sugar and anesthetic into ligaments to stimulant healing.
After a series of 4-10 treatments, stability is greatly improved,
therefore decreasing stress to the joints and/or disc. Come
